Simultaneous removal of H{sub 2}S and NH{sub 3} in coal gasification processes. Quarterly report, July 1, 1994--September 30, 1994

The objective of this study is to develop advanced high-temperature coal gas desulfurization mixed-metal oxide sorbents with stable ammonia decomposition materials at 550-800{degree}C (1022-1472{degree}F). The specific objectives of the project are to: (i) develop combined sorbent-catalyst materials capable of removing hydrogen sulfide to less than 20 ppmv and ammonia by at least 90 percent. (ii) Carry out comparative fixed-bed studies of absorption and regeneration with various formulations of sorbent-catalyst systems and select most promising sorbent-catalyst type. (iii) Conduct long-term (at least 30 cycles) durability and chemical reactivity in the fixed-bed with the superior sorbent-catalyst.
